Understanding Antibiotic Resistance A Growing Global Threat
Antibiotic resistance is one of the most pressing public health challenges facing the world today. It refers to the ability of bacteria to withstand the effects of medications that once effectively treated infections. This phenomenon not only complicates treatment options but also significantly increases the risk of disease spread, severe illness, and mortality.
The emergence of antibiotic resistance is linked to several factors, primarily the overuse and misuse of antibiotics in both humans and animals. In many parts of the world, antibiotics are prescribed without proper medical justification, often for viral infections against which they are ineffective. Furthermore, the self-medication with leftover antibiotics is prevalent, where individuals consume antibiotics without professional guidance. Such practices not only contribute to the development of resistant bacteria but also reduce the effectiveness of existing antibiotics.

The consequences of antibiotic resistance are dire. According to the Centers for Disease Control and Prevention (CDC), at least 2.8 million people in the United States alone are infected with antibiotic-resistant bacteria each year, leading to approximately 35,000 deaths. The situation is similar across the globe; the WHO estimates that antimicrobial resistance could cause 10 million deaths annually by 2050 if no action is taken. This crisis not only affects individual health outcomes but also places a heavy burden on healthcare systems and economies.
Addressing antibiotic resistance requires a multifaceted approach. Public awareness campaigns are crucial in educating patients and healthcare providers about the appropriate use of antibiotics. Individuals must understand that taking antibiotics for viral infections, such as the common cold or flu, is not only ineffective but harmful. Health professionals should adhere to guidelines regarding the prescription of antibiotics, ensuring they are only used when truly necessary.
Moreover, improved diagnostic tools are essential to quickly and accurately identify infections and determine their causes. This will aid in making informed decisions about whether antibiotics are required. Additionally, ongoing research and development of new antibiotics and alternative treatments are critical in staying ahead of resistant strains. Efforts must also focus on infection prevention, including robust vaccination programs and effective sanitation practices, to reduce the incidence of infections and the need for antibiotics.
Collaboration on a global scale is vital for tackling antibiotic resistance. Countries must work together to share data, research findings, and best practices. The One Health approach, which connects human, animal, and environmental health, is crucial in combating antibiotic resistance. By recognizing the interconnectedness of these domains, effective strategies can be developed to address this global crisis.
In conclusion, antibiotic resistance is a serious public health issue that demands immediate attention. By promoting responsible antibiotic use, enhancing diagnostics, investing in research, and fostering international collaboration, we can work to mitigate this threat. The fight against antibiotic resistance is not just a challenge for health professionals; it is a responsibility that encompasses society as a whole. Only through collective action can we ensure the effectiveness of antibiotics for future generations.
